1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the main function of arteries in the circulatory system?

Back

Arteries carry oxygenated blood away from the heart to the tissues of the body.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What occurs during ventricular systole in the heart?

Back

During ventricular systole, the ventricles contract, increasing pressure and forcing blood into the aorta and pulmonary artery.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does the P wave represent in an ECG tracing?

Back

The P wave represents the depolarization and contraction of the atria.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a dissociation curve in relation to hemoglobin?

Back

A dissociation curve shows the relationship between the partial pressure of oxygen and the percentage saturation of hemoglobin with oxygen.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the role of the mitral (bicuspid) valve?

Back

The mitral valve prevents backflow of blood from the left ventricle into the left atrium during ventricular contraction.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What type of blood vessel has valves to prevent backflow?

Back

Veins have valves to prevent the backflow of blood as it returns to the heart.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the significance of the aortic pressure during the cardiac cycle?

Back

Aortic pressure increases during ventricular systole, indicating that blood is being pumped from the heart into the systemic circulation.
